WARNING
For removal and installation of the passenger's side air bag module, always observe the
service procedures described in GROUP 52B, Air Bag Module and Clock Spring
.

CAUTION
•
Refer to GROUP 52B, SRS Service Precautions
and Air bag Module and Clock Spring
before removing the passenger side air bag module.
•
Do not subject the SRS-ECU to any shocks when removing or installing the instrument panel.
